About
Genius Annotation
Phantogram describes a close, if not intimate, relationship with someone suffering from addiction and severe anxiety. The chorus pleas for this turbulent person to stay still, to just be in peace, but this is frustratingly impossible.
The reasons for this person’s struggles are not directly disclosed, leaving the listener with an unresolved discomfort as one empathizes with the helplessness of the speaker to help this loved one and the day-to-day mental prison in which the speaker’s friend is living.
